Credential Analyst-NCQA, URAC and CMS

Worldwide Salaried Open

About the position Under supervision, this role is responsible for performing oversight on essential credentialing functions to attain and maintain quality providers in the dental network. This role also conducts audits for credentialing as well as network data quality. Understands credentialing policies and procedures per NCQA, URAC and CMS standards and other regulatory requirements. Serves as a liaison to delegated entities and vendors to ensure current and adequate credentialing process are in place. Develops and performs queries for data reporting purposes to include directories, ad hoc reports, and network management reports. Responsible for the monitoring and maintenance of credentialing and re-credentialing polies and program as well as state and federal requirements to ensure compliance is met. This role will provide operational and industry knowledge to ensure credentialing practices.

Requirements

  • Bachelor degree and 2 years of experience in accreditation programs (i.e., NCQA, URAC and CMS programs) or 6 years of experience in accreditation programs
  • Proficiency in accreditation program standards. (ex. NCQA, URAC, CMS)
  • Knowledge of state and federal requirements for contracting and credentialing.
  • Attention to detail and ability to track information to defined quality standards
  • Knowledge of documents and their contents used in provider contracting, including applications, agreements, fee schedules, and credentialing.
  • Knowledge of provider contracting terms.
  • Analytical skills
  • Demonstrated experience understanding and maintaining detailed complex provider records.
  • Attention to detail and ability to enter data and meet defined quality standards
  • Experience balancing multiple priorities while meeting commitments for quality and delivery at agreed upon schedules.
  • Clear and concise verbal and written communication skills.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office products, Excel, email and Internet.
  • Ability to work well in a team environment.
